Yellow Veil Pictures has just announced the U.S. release of the critically acclaimed French neo-noir The Other Laurens. This stylish and darkly comedic thriller will hit select Alamo Drafthouse Cinemas this August, followed by its VOD arrival.

Claude Schmitz directed the film that stars Olivier Rabourdin. It follows a down-on-his-luck private investigator mistaken for his criminal twin brother. He is drawn deeper into a dangerous underworld. He must confront his own identity and the blurred lines between reality and illusion.

The Other Laurens has garnered praise from critics worldwide, with comparisons to the work of David Lynch and Quentin Tarantino. The film’s blend of noir aesthetics, dark humor, and unexpected twists has captivated audiences worldwide.

The film made its world premiere at the Cannes Film Festival and its North American premiere at Fantastic Fest, winning the Grand Prix and Best Actor Prize for Olivier Rabourdin at the Brussels International Film Festival last year.
